A doula, unlike a midwife or OB/GYN, does not have medical training; instead, they are there to provide a calming voice of experience, assist with relaxation techniques and breathing exercises, and provide guidance on labor positions, among other things. Its no surprise that new mothers can feel overwhelmed with her new baby; doulas trained in postpartum techniques can provide much needed assistance by educating her on infant breastfeeding techniques, preparing meals with the correct nutritional content, showing the new mother methods for bathing, feeding, and comforting the newborn. A birth doula assists in various ways; for example, they will offer labor support by massaging you, practicing breathing techniques with you, and helping you move into different positions. Become a Doula Career Choices for Becoming a Doula Find a Doula Meet Our Trainers Our Training Schedule Become a Certified Childbirth Educator Become a Doulas that provide support in the first few weeks after birth of the baby are called postpartum doulas. Postpartum doulas ease the mother into her new role as a new mom by giving her emotional support and education advice on newborn care.
